The U.S. Navy's aircraft carrier fleet must meet the forward presence requirements of theater commanders. With a decreasing fleet size, planners must balance the timing of maintenance, training, and deployment with presence and surge demands. Evaluating multiple one- and two-deployment scenarios per cycle, RAND examines the feasibility of different cycle lengths, their effect on carrier forward presence, and their impact on shipyard workloads
